Who Is Crossville, Inc.?
Located in Crossville, Tennessee, at the foothills of the Cumberland Plateau, Crossville,
Inc. began manufacturing porcelain stone at its newly constructed plant in August
1986. Today, Crossville, Inc., is the largest domestic manufacturer of porcelain
stone, and operates the first U.S. tile plant designed to manufacture large-unit
porcelain tiles. Planned and equipped to be state-of-the-art facilities, Crossville's
plants manufacture tiles ranging in size from 3" x 3" to 18" x 18".
